The TIA/EIA structural standards for the maximum intervals between tower inspections is three-years for a guyed tower and five-years for a self-support tower.   For Class III structures and structures in coastal regions, in corrosive environments, and in areas of frequent vandalism it is recommended that more frequent inspection be performed.

World Tower offers a full tower inspection in compliance with the condition assessment guidelines provided in the TIA/EIA structural standards Annex J.

World Tower provides a complete inspection of the following areas:

  • Structure Condition

  • Finish

  • Lighting

  • Grounding

  • Antennas and Lines

  • Other Appurtenances

  • Insulator Condition

  • Guys

  • Concrete Foundations
